Jobs for Management Information Systems Grads in Georgia
In this state, there are 19,450 people employed in jobs related to a MIS degree, compared to 621,900 nationwide.

Wages for Management Information Systems Jobs in Georgia
A typical salary for a MIS grad in the state is $92,390, compared to a typical salary of $89,580 nationwide.
